Hodges vs. Daytona

Both Hodges University and Daytona College are 4 years schools located in Florida. The following statements compare Hodges University and Daytona College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Daytona's tuition ($39,100) is more expensive than Hodges ($15,580).
  • Both schools have same students to faculty ratio of 10 to 1.
  • Hodges (443 students) is larger than Daytona (180 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Hodges ($6,298) has higher amount of financial aid than Daytona ($4,628).
  • Daytona's graduation rate (75%) is higher than Hodges (19%).
